using System;
using System.Text.RegularExpressions;
public class Example
{
public static void Main()
{
string pattern = @"(?<=, )[^,]+(?=, CL)";
string input = @"""8 IN, Ball Valve, Trunnion, Gen manu, CL 900, BW, Body LTCS, Metal Seat, Gear Operated, Trim Alloy 825, Full Bore, NACE MR 0175/ISO 15156 -with extended pup-piece as pipe schedule. VBFW 91Z08""";
RegexOptions options = RegexOptions.Multiline;
foreach (Match m in Regex.Matches(input, pattern, options))
{
Console.WriteLine("'{0}' found at index {1}.", m.Value, m.Index);
}
}
}
